The referer header URL parsing can throw an uncaught error if the referer is malformed, causing an unhandled exception instead of a proper HTTP error response.
View Details
Analysis
Unhandled URL parsing error in Google Static Maps proxy referer validation
What fails: The google-static-maps-proxy.ts event handler crashes with an unhandled TypeError when the referer header contains a malformed URL.
How to reproduce:
# Send a request with a malformed referer header
curl -H "Referer: this-is-not-a-valid-url" http://localhost:3000/api/google-static-mapsResult: Returns 500 Internal Server Error due to unhandled exception from new URL() constructor throwing TypeError: Invalid URL
Expected: Should return 400 Bad Request with proper error message, consistent with other validation errors in the function that use createError() for HTTP error responses
Details: The referer header can contain any string value from the HTTP request. When new URL(referer) is called without try-catch wrapping (line 31), it throws a TypeError for malformed URLs. According to JavaScript best practices, the new URL() constructor should be wrapped in error handling when parsing untrusted input.

π Description
Google Maps had several pain points: CORS issues with static map placeholders when using
crossOriginEmbedderPolicy, no way to switch map styles based on color mode, and MarkerClusterer types breaking builds when the package wasn't installed.Added a server-side static maps proxy that serves images from same origin (fixing CORS) with caching to reduce API costs. The proxy keeps the API key server-side only and validates referer headers to prevent abuse. Added
mapIdsprop to switch between light/dark Map IDs reactively when color mode changes. Replaced top-level type imports with inline types so MarkerClusterer is truly optional. Also fixed PinElement memory leak and importLibrary cache not retrying on failure.
